Episode Description:This week, we’re breaking down something almost all women feel during the holiday season but rarely talk about: the quiet panic that hits the second you walk into a party. That moment when you suddenly notice your outfit, hair, body, voice — all of it. We open with the Invisible Guest Theory, a piece of wisdom that instantly shifts the pressure we put on ourselves in social settings.We walk through the biology behind social anxiety, why moms feel it even more, and what actually creates that nagging “everyone is judging me” feeling. Spoiler: they’re not. They’re stuck in the same mental loop about themselves.Then we get into the freedom of realizing you are not the main character in anyone else’s world during a holiday gathering. You’re passing through their universe, not auditioning for it. Once you understand that, the pressure lifts.We also get into the practical prep that helps the night go smoother — like planning your outfit ahead of time so you’re not tearing apart your closet on the way out the door, and having a quick car chat with your partner or whoever you’re attending with to set expectations, create a loose game plan, and even decide on a polite exit strategy.
